Davontae is a boy's baby name of modern American origin, an elaboration of Davonte or Davontae — combining David (from the Hebrew, meaning 'beloved') with the -onte suffix influenced by Italian and French naming patterns. This construction reflects the rich tradition of creative name-building in African American naming culture.

Popularity by Decade
| Decade | Births | Trend |
|---|---|---|
| 2020s | 102 | ▼ |
| 2010s | 304 | ▼ |
| 2000s | 564 | ▲ |
| 1990s | 557 | ▲ |
| 1980s | 10 | — |

Year-by-Year Data
View complete yearly data(37 years, 1988–2024)
| Year | Births | Rank |
|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 16 | #5699 |
| 2023 | 20 | #4912 |
| 2022 | 19 | #5067 |
| 2021 | 23 | #4395 |
| 2020 | 24 | #4171 |
| 2019 | 26 | #4029 |
| 2018 | 31 | #3550 |
| 2017 | 24 | #4249 |
| 2016 | 30 | #3609 |
| 2015 | 26 | #4004 |
| 2014 | 34 | #3248 |
| 2013 | 33 | #3279 |
| 2012 | 32 | #3391 |
| 2011 | 34 | #3255 |
| 2010 | 34 | #3257 |
| 2009 | 40 | #2960 |
| 2008 | 54 | #2384 |
| 2007 | 50 | #2510 |
| 2006 | 68 | #1974 |
| 2005 | 55 | #2189 |
Source: U.S. Social Security Administration. Showing years with 5+ recorded births.
